Crab Fried Rice is undeniably my go-to favorite. It's packed with lump crabmeat and infused with aromatic Thai seasonings. Made in less than 15 minutes, it is a great addition to your repertoire of easy dinners!

Ingredients
- 3 cups cooked and cooled white rice
- 1 cup lump crabmeat
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il (or olive or avocado or peanut oil)
- 3 green onions, thinly sliced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- ½ cup shredded carrots (or stir fry vegetables)
- 2 eggs lightly beaten
- 1½ soy sauce (or fish sauce)
- 1½ oyster sauce
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on ground pepper
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- green onions for garnishing optional
- Thai basil for garnishing optional
Instructions
- Heat oil in a large skillet or large wok over medium high heat. Add green onions and garlic. Saute for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
- Add in the shredded carrots. Cook for 1-2 minutes. Push the vegetables to one side of the skillet.
- Pour the beaten eggs into the open space and scramble until just cooked - about 30 seconds. Incorporate the eggs with the vegetables.
- Add rice, sesame oil, soy sauce, oyster sauce, salt, pepper, and sugar. Stir-fry the mixture, ensuring the sauces are evenly distributed. Then, gently fold in the crabmeat. Let the bottom get crispy for 2 minutes. Stir, and repeat a couple of times.
- Transfer the crab fried rice to a serving dish. Garnish with Thai basil, green onions, and a squeeze of lime juice, if desired. Serve hot.
